Bumblebees & Bogs for Beginners

May 24 @ 14:00 - 16:00
Free

Take a family-friendly stroll along Girley Bog’s short 1.2km loop trail starting at Drewstown Car Park and learn about the natural history of raised bogs and the flora and fauna found in these special habitats.

Facilitated by Meath County Council’s Biodiversity Officer, there will be particular attention given to the citizen science activities that are to be encouraged in places like Girley Bog, whereby members of the public are encouraged to observe and record wildlife in order to build our knowledge on Ireland’s biodiversity.

Participants are advised that the trail and boardwalk is uneven and may be slippy in certain weather conditions. All participants are recommended to wear suitable sturdy footwear and appropriate outdoor clothing.
